Tom Hardy Reportedly Axed From Paramount+’s MobLand Season 3
Tom Hardy has reportedly been axed from the third season of the hit Paramount+ show MobLand after clashing with producers.
Veteran entertainment journalist Matthew Belloni reported in his Puck newsletter on Thursday, May 21, that Paramount opted not to pick up Hardy’s option for season 3 amid on-set tensions during the production of the show’s second season.
The report alleged that Hardy, 48, was late to set, asked to give notes on the script and attempted to change scripted dialogue.
Us Weekly has reached out to representatives for Hardy, Paramount+ and MobLand producer 101 Studios for comment.
Hardy plays lead character Harry Da Souza, a fixer for the Harrigan crime family, in the hit gang drama costarring Helen Mirren, Pierce Brosnan and more.
MobLand, created by Ronan Bennett and executive produced by Guy Ritchie, premiered in March 2025 and was an immediate success for Paramount+. Hardy serves as an executive producer on the series.
Paramount+ renewed the drama for a second season in June 2025, citing the show’s impact on the streaming service.
“With over 26 million viewers and climbing, MobLand has become a resounding triumph driven by the creative brilliance of Guy, Jez [Butterworth], Ronan and David C. Glasser, and brought to life by the powerhouse performances by Tom, Pierce, and Helen,” Paramount co-CEO and president of Showtime/MTV Entertainment Chris McCarthy said at the time. “We are elated to greenlight a second season of this global phenomenon, which has dominated both domestic and international charts and soared to #1 in the United Kingdom.”
“MobLand was one of those incredible moments where Chris McCarthy came to us with the vision of creating the next great mob series, and after traversing the U.K. countryside in a quest to land Guy Ritchie, we both came to the realization that we knew the exact formula. With the extraordinary talent of Guy, Ronan, Jez and our incredible cast, we brought that vision to life,” added executive producer and 101 Studios CEO David C. Glasser.
Writer and executive producer Jez Butterworth said at the time, “TV was a brand-new world for me and I was reluctant to commit to a TV overall, but Chris, David, and the teams at Paramount and 101 Studios, completely changed my perspective with their bold creative vision and razor-sharp strategic insight. Collaborating with Chris, David, Guy and our stellar cast has been nothing short of inspiring and I’m excited to dive into the second season of MobLand.”
MobLand season 1 is available to stream on Paramount+. A season 2 premiere date has yet to be announced.

‘The Ballad of Wallis Island’
The sophomore feature from James Griffiths, The Ballad of Wallis Island is a sweet British comedy-drama that came out to little to no fanfare. Three-time Oscar nominee Carey Mulligan stars opposite co-writer Tom Basden and consummate scene-stealer Tim Key in this musical tale about letting go of the past. Muligan and Basden play Nell and Herb, a former folk duo who separated under unclear circumstances, only to reunite years later when eccentric mega fan Charles Heath (Key) pays them a generous sum to perform for him.
The Ballad of Wallis Island is perfect for all those fans of sweet, unsuspecting, and straightforward romance and drama. It doesn’t try anything necessarily new, nor does it concern itself with reinventing the wheel. Instead, it merely offers a heartfelt, honest, and sorrowful story about overcoming grief and opening oneself to life’s possibilities. Mulligan is great, as usual, but Key and Basden are the secret sauce that makes The Ballad of Wallis Island work. If you’re in the mood for some nice folk music or want a surprisingly wholesome tale of friendship, then this remarkable and undervalued gem is the right choice.
‘Black Bag’
Once upon a time, Steven Soderbergh was one of the leading auteurs working in Hollywood, and while his movies were never particularly box office juggernauts, his name still carried significant weight. In other words, a new Soderbergh movie was an event. Nowadays, however, things are very different, with the director’s most recent offerings flying so under the radar that they’re not even registered. It’s a shame, because the quality of his offerings hasn’t decreased, and last year’s sleek crime caper Black Bag proves it.
Oscar winner Cate Blanchett and Oscar nominee Michael Fassbender lead an impressive cast, including Regé-Jean Page, Tom Burke, Marisa Abela, and Pierce Brosnan. The plot centers on George Woodhouse (Fassbender), a British Intelligence officer tasked with investigating a list of potential traitors. To his shock, his wife, Kathryn (Blanchett), is among them. Like other Soderbergh movies, Black Bag is stylish, tightly constructed, and dryly witty, an irresistible tale of duplicity and betrayal set in the world of British espionage. More interesting, however, is its depiction of marriage as a constant match of psychological one-upmanship. Fassbender is good as the troubled protagonist, but Blanchett is outstanding as the elusive Kathryn, making an already entertaining film even better.
‘John Candy: I Like Me’
Colin Hanks (yes, Tom Hanks‘ son) directs John Candy: I Like Me, a documentary about the career of iconic comedian John Candy. The film uses rare, never-before-seen footage of Candy’s private life and features interviews and audio commentary from his friends and family. Major figures appear in the doc, including Dan Aykroyd, Mel Brooks, Macaulay Culkin, Tom Hanks, Steven Martin, Bill Murray, and Martin Short.
Documentaries are not everyone’s cup of tea, but Candy is such a beloved figure in entertainment that it’s hard to resist. John Candy: I Like Me is an insightful, revelatory, and heartbreaking but ultimately rewarding intimate look at one of the greatest comedic talents of the 20th century. Instead of solely focusing on the circumstances of his death, the documentary serves as a celebration of his gifts and a chance to know a different, softer side to him. Ultimately, John Candy: I Like Me is both a love letter to its subject and a tribute to the considerable legacy he left behind. Even if you’re not a fan of documentaries, this one is well worth your time.

A Forgotten Comedy Trilogy Will Help Determine The Next James Bond
By Chris Snellgrove
| Published

Right now, one of the most powerful entities in the entire world is on the hunt for James Bond. No, I’m not talking about Blofeld, Goldfinger, or any of the rest of 007’s colorful rogues’ gallery. Instead, I’m talking about Amazon, which (after shelling out a whopping billion dollars) now has full creative control over the James Bond character. They’re eager to start pumping out new movies and (in all likelihood) new TV shows, but that can’t happen until they find a new Bond actor to replace Daniel Craig.
Right now, fans are mostly speculating who will get the coveted role, and various names (including Callum Turner, Aaron Taylor-Johnson, and even Jacob Elordi) keep churning through the rumor mill. However, it’s arguably more interesting to speculate about what the new 007 films will actually be like. Will we be getting more movies in the ultra-serious vein of the Craig movies? The answer is almost certainly “no,” and it’s all due to the Austin Powers films, which parodied James Bond and absolutely dominated the ‘90s.
A License To Shag

I know what you’re thinking. “What in the name of a Swedish-made penis enlarger does a ‘90s film franchise have to do with modern Bond?” Back in 2012, Daniel Craig sat down for an interview with the 007 fan site MI6 in order to promote Skyfall. He began discussing why Casino Royale was such a serious movie compared to many of the earlier Bond films. Mid-interview, Craig surprisingly laid the blame for this creative decision on one man: Austin Powers star Mike Myers.
“We had to destroy the myth because Mike Myers f*cked us,” Craig said with hilarious vulgarity. While acknowledging his love for the actor, the Knives Out star reiterated how his franchise had been done dirty by the former Saturday Night Live icon. “He kind of f*cked us; made it impossible to do the gags.” In other words, the Austin Powers films did such a good job making fun of the sillier aspects of 007 that Craig’s Bond films had to throw those things out unless they wanted filmgoers to see their new star as an instant punchline.
Back To Brosnan (Sort Of)

So, the popularity of the Austin Powers films explains why Daniel Craig’s 007 movies were so serious. Why, though, do I think Mike Myers’ movies will help determine the tone of the next Bond film? Simple: it’s all about course correction. The Austin Powers movies made the Bond filmmakers feel as if they had leaned too far into the silliness of their character, so they tried to fix this by making 007 into more of a grim warrior. Now, the ultra-gritty Bond has been the norm for over two decades, so it stands to reason that the pendulum will swing the other way and we’ll get a more lighthearted 007.
Now, does that mean that the next Bond actor will be as silly as Roger Moore, whose zany antics largely inspired the Austin Powers character? Probably not. But we’ll likely get someone akin to Pierce Brosnan, who did a great job blending serious and comedic elements into his 007 movies. That would help to give the Amazon era of the franchise more mainstream appeal while distinguishing the new Bond from other, overly serious action heroes like John Reacher and John Wick.

Vought Rising Trailer Brings The Boys Universe Back to Its Darkest Roots : Coastal House Media
Amazon and MGM+ may have just delivered one of the most unique superhero shows in years with Spider-Noir. Early reactions across the internet have been overwhelmingly positive, with critics praising the series’ striking noir aesthetic, Nicolas Cage’s magnetic performance, and its refreshing departure from the traditional Marvel formula.
Set in a gritty 1930s New York, the series follows Ben Reilly, an aging private investigator haunted by his past life as the city’s masked vigilante. Rather than leaning into modern superhero spectacle, Spider-Noir embraces detective noir, gangster drama, smoky jazz lounges, femme fatales, and brutal street-level crime. The result feels less like a standard comic book adaptation and more like a lost Humphrey Bogart thriller that just happens to feature Spider-Man.
And at the center of it all is Nicolas Cage, who appears completely locked into the role. Multiple critics have singled him out as the show’s greatest strength, with some describing the performance as “peak Nicolas Cage” in the best possible way. Cage reportedly approached the character as “70% Bogart and 30% Bugs Bunny,” and somehow that bizarre combination works perfectly for the tone this series is chasing.
One of the biggest talking points online has been the show’s presentation. Spider-Noir will be available in both full color and authentic black-and-white versions, though nearly every early reaction suggests the monochrome format is the definitive way to watch it. Critics say the black-and-white cinematography gives the series a timeless quality that separates it from nearly every superhero project currently streaming.
Spider-man: Noir [credit: MGM studios]
The internet reaction has also compared the atmosphere and style to Batman: The Animated Series, with viewers praising its moody visuals, mature storytelling, and commitment to noir worldbuilding.
That said, some reviews note the supporting cast occasionally gets overshadowed by Cage’s larger-than-life performance. Still, most critics agree the series succeeds because it fully commits to its identity instead of trying to imitate the MCU formula.
Currently sitting at 82% on Rotten Tomatoes, Spider-Noir already looks poised to become a breakout hit among comic book fans looking for something darker, stranger, and far more cinematic than the average superhero series.
Marvel has spent years experimenting with multiverse storytelling, but Spider-Noir may finally be the project that proves these alternate Spider-Man worlds can truly stand on their own.

Britney Spears Invited Police Over for Lasagna in DUI Arrest
Britney Spears invited police officers to her house for lasagna and to use her pool during her March DUI arrest, according to newly released footage.
“You can come to my house. I’ll make you food or lasagna or whatever you want. I have a pool,” Spears, 44, told officers when she was pulled over by the California Highway Patrol in Ventura County, California, on March 4, as seen in a video published by TMZ on Thursday, May 21.
Spears also spoke in a British accent at times, per a police report obtained by Us Weekly.
“Her mood changed from confrontational and agitated to flamboyant and compliant,” the arresting officer noted in his report.
The police report noted that the officer who pulled the singer over detected a “distinct odor of an alcoholic beverage” from her vehicle. Spears told officers she had had only one champagne mimosa seven hours earlier.
“I could probably drink four bottles of wine and take care of you. I’m an angel,” she said.
According to the report, the “Womanizer” singer confirmed she had taken prescription drugs on the day of her arrest, including 200mg of anticonvulsant and mood stabilizer Lamictal, 40mg of antidepressant Prozac and 2.5 mg of ADHD medication Adderall.
“[An officer] located a brown purse that contained a bottle of pills labeled ‘Adderall,’ which were not prescribed to Spears,” the report said. “[The officer] also observed an empty wine glass in the cup holder between the front driver seat and passenger seat.”
Us Weekly reached out to Spears’ representative for comment.
Spears was initially charged with driving under the influence, but the star pleaded guilty to the lesser charge of “wet reckless driving” earlier in May as part of a plea deal.
“Through her plea today, Britney has accepted responsibility for her conduct,” Spears’ lawyer, Michael Goldstein, told Us in a statement on May 4. “She has taken significant steps to implement positive change, which is clearly reflected in the Ventura County District Attorney’s decision to reduce the charge in this case and dismiss the DUI. Britney appreciates this discretion and is also grateful for the outpouring of support she has received.”
“This was an unfortunate incident that is completely inexcusable,” Spears’ spokesperson told Us following her arrest in March. “Britney is going to take the right steps and comply with the law, and hopefully this can be the first step in long overdue change that needs to occur in Britney’s life. Hopefully, she can get the help and support she needs during this difficult time.”
